Iltifat — Types and Purposes in the Quran

هُوَ ٱلَّذِي يُسَيِّرُكُمۡ فِي ٱلۡبَرِّ وَٱلۡبَحۡرِ
— يونس الآية 22
Three basic types: (1) Third to second person: "Praise to Allah...You alone we worship." (2) Second to third: "Until you are in ships, and they sail with them..." (10:22). (3) First to third or reverse.

Purposes: Renewing listener's attention, shifting from statement to direct address, specifying the individual after addressing the group.
Source: Al-Zarkashi (3/295); Al-Suyuti (3/228); Al-Zamakhshari
